Direct Answer
According to the game’s official wiki, you can hold up to 5,000 gold bars at a time in Fortnite. This is the maximum amount of gold that you can carry before it stops counting. It’s essential to note that this limit applies to each player, and it’s not possible to exceed this limit.
Why Gold is Important
Gold bars play a crucial role in Fortnite, and they can be used to purchase various items and weapons. Here are some of the things you can buy with gold bars:
- Weapons: Gold bars can be used to purchase weapons from vending machines, including rifles, shotguns, and other firearms.
- Items: You can use gold bars to buy items like health kits, ammo boxes, and other consumables.
- Augments: Gold bars can be used to purchase Augments, which are special perks that can give you an edge in battle.
- NPCs: You can hire NPCs (non-player characters) to fight alongside you in battle.
